About The Position

The Department of Ophthalmology is seeking applications for a PRN Medical Assistant (open rank Healthcare Tech 1-II) to take photos at several clinic locations in Denver and Aurora. This position will work on patient recruitment and consents for research imaging. Operates specialized ophthalmic equipment. This role will be responsible for providing the research consent form, educating regarding the study, providing answers to patient’s questions, and capturing the retina’s picture. The Ophthalmology Department is providing imaging services OCT and Non-mydriatic fundus photography services. The University of Colorado offers a highly competitive compensation, retirement, and benefits package. Medical Assistants are responsible for providing outstanding customer service to the assigned physicians, referring providers and patient. The individual in this position will perform a broad spectrum of duties related to the effective and efficient clinical assistance of patients for outpatient visits and procedures. This includes maintaining precise interactions with nurses, physicians, and any other departments or functions involved in the delivery of patient care services.

Responsibilities

  • Under direct supervision of an eye care provider, assists with performing patient care and patient flow.
  • Under direct supervision of an eye care provider: Performs diagnostic imaging and testing including OCT, fundus photography, visual field testing. Administers intravenous agents in preparation for fluorescein angiography.
  • Provides documentation, educates patients, creates appointments and enters charges.
  • Performs clinical and administrative duties in support of assigned area.
  • Within scope of job, requires critical thinking skills, decisive judgement and the ability to work with minimal supervision. Must be able to work in a fast-paced environment and take appropriate action.
  • Assist with and oversee the day-to-day operations of clinical trials.
  • Assist in obtaining medical history and current medication treatment information.
  • Confirm eligibility for subject to be enrolled into a research study, review research study protocol, inclusion/exclusion criteria for clinical trails.
  • Perform informed consent process or ensures that the informed consent process has occurred, is properly documented, and that informed consent form documents are filed as required
  • Assist with protocol, Informed Consent, and related documents to be amended.
  • Assist with data entries, modify RedCap tools as needed.
  • Assist and maintain communication for updates with the research teams.
